What type of knife is best for trimming brisket?

News Discuss 
The best knife for trimming brisket is a flexible boning knife (typically 5-6 inches). Here’s why: Flexibility: Allows you to glide along the contours of the brisket, removing silver skin and excess fat with precision without wasting meat.
